Abstract
Background Neurocysticercosis (NCC), a predominant parasitic disease that affects the central nervous system and presents with diverse clinical manifestations, is a major contributor to acquired epilepsy worldwide, particularly in low-, middle-, and upper middle-income nations, such as China. In China, the Yunnan Province bears a significant burden of this disease. Objective To describe the demographic, clinical, and radiological features as well as serum and cerebrospinal fluid antibodies to cysticercus in patients with NCC from Dali, Yunnan Province, China. Materials and Methods This retrospective study included patients who were diagnosed with NCC at The First Affiliated Hospital of Dali University between January 2018 and May 2023 and were residing in Dali, Yunnan Province, China. Results A total of 552 patients with NCC were included, of which 33.3% belonged to Bai ethnicity. The clinical presentation of NCC exhibited variability that was influenced by factors such as the number, location, and stage of the parasites. Epilepsy/seizure (49.9%) was the most prevalent symptom, with higher occurrence in the degenerative stage of cysts (P < 0.001). Compared with other locations, cysticerci located in the brain parenchyma are more likely to lead to seizures/epilepsy (OR = 17.45, 95% CI: 7.96-38.25) and headaches (OR = 3.02, 95% CI: 1.23-7.41). Seizures/epilepsy are more likely in patients with cysts in the vesicular (OR = 2.71, 95% CI: 1.12-6.61) and degenerative (OR = 102.38, 95% CI: 28.36-369.60) stages than those in the calcified stage. Seizures was not dependent on the number of lesions. All NCC patients underwent anthelminthic therapy, with the majority receiving albendazole (79.7%). Conclusion This study provides valuable clinical insights into NCC patients in Dali and underscores the significance of NCC as a leading preventable cause of epilepsy.

Abstract
Neurocysticercosis (NCC) is a potentially life-threatening condition caused by the zoonotic cestode, Taenia solium. Pigs are the typical intermediate hosts for T. solium but humans can become infected and develop NCC upon ingesting parasite eggs that are shed in the feces of an infected person. The objective of this study was to estimate the monetary burden of neurocysticercosis (NCC) on hospitalized patients from Muli County, China. Muli is an agricultural county in Liangshan Prefecture, Sichuan Province, China where pigs are raised and the zoonotic cestode, Taenia solium, is endemic. Demographic and treatment data were collected from the Muli County Health Insurance Department on hospitalized individuals with an NCC diagnosis between 2014 and 2021. These patients represent residents of Muli County that purchased health insurance and received treatment in a public hospital in Sichuan Province. Hospital costs were converted from Chinese renminbi (RMB) to United States dollars (US$) for month and year of hospitalization and adjusted for inflation. Individuals with missing hospital information were excluded from analysis. For indirect costs, annual average salary for Liangshan Prefecture working-age adults was obtained to calculate productivity losses based on number of hospitalization days and travel days to and from the hospital. Transportation costs were evaluated based on estimated bus fare to and from the hospital. Out of 70 patients identified from 2014 to 2021, 68 had complete records, of which 47.1% were male (n = 33) and the median age at first hospitalization was 34 years. Total estimated cost for these patients was US$228,341.98. Direct costs contributed 62.5% (US$142,785.25) and indirect costs were 37.5% (US$85,556.73) of the total cost. The estimated median cost per case was US$2,078.69. Individuals with a single hospitalization (n = 41) cost a median of US$1,572.03 and those with multiple hospitalizations (n = 27) cost a median of US$4,169.95. The median total cost per NCC case was 18.6% of the average wage for a Liangshan Prefecture resident in 2021. While the study was limited to those with insurance coverage, monetary burden on the local population is likely substantial. Public health policies aimed at reducing transmission should be implemented to decrease the economic burden of NCC on this region.

Abstract
BACKGROUND Neurocysticercosis is one of the most common causes of acquired epilepsy worldwide. Caused by Taenia solium, the infection uses pigs as an intermediate host and thus is often associated with proximity to and consumption of pigs. OBJECTIVE This review explores the epidemiology of neurocysticercosis in endemic regions across Africa, Asia, and Latin America and examines common risk factors in these areas. METHODS A literature review was conducted using pubmed to search for articles with key words including neurocysticercosis, Taenia, solium, epidemiology, and the names of countries and continents in the regions of interest. FINDINGS Multiple risk factors for neurocysticercosis were identified, including inadequate regulation of pig farms and food safety, poor sanitation, and water contamination. In addition, additional barriers to appropriate diagnosis and management were found, including resource limitations and poor health literacy. CONCLUSION Despite its global prevalence, effective limitation of neurocysticercosis is still achievable through projects which address common risk factors.

Abstract
Neurocysticercosis (NCC), a leading global cause of severe progressive headache and epilepsy, in developed or affluent countries is mostly diagnosed among immigrants from poor or developing Taenia solium taeniasis-endemic countries. Taeniasis carriers in Kuwait are routinely screened by insensitive stool microscopy. In this study, enzyme-linked immunoelectrotransfer blot (EITB) was used as a confirmatory test for NCC. Screening was performed on 970 patients referred for suspected NCC on the basis of relevant history and/or ring-enhancing lesions on computed tomography and/or magnetic resonance imaging during a 14-year period in Kuwait. Demographic data and clinical details were retrieved from laboratory or hospital records. EITB was positive in 150 subjects (15.5%), including 98 expatriates mostly originating from taeniasis-endemic countries and, surprisingly, 52 Kuwaiti nationals. The clinical details of 48 of 50 NCC cases diagnosed during 2014–2019 were available. Most common symptoms included seizures, persistent headache with/without fever, and fits or loss of consciousness. Cysticercal lesions were located at various brain regions in 39 of 48 patients. Multiple members of 3 families with NCC were identified; infection was linked to domestic workers from taeniasis-endemic countries and confirmed in at least 1 family. Our data show that NCC is predominantly imported in Kuwait by expatriates originating from taeniasis-endemic countries who transmit the infection to Kuwaiti citizens.

Abstract
The enzyme-linked immunoelectrotransfer blot (EITB) assay to detect antibodies in serum is a complementary tool for the diagnosis of neurocysticercosis (NCC). Presence of at least one glycoprotein band corresponding to a Taenia solium (T. solium) antigen indicates a positive result; however, EITB assays have multiple glycoprotein bands, and previous work has suggested that band patterns may have additional diagnostic value. We included 58 participants with a definitive diagnosis of NCC who received care at the Instituto Nacional de Neurología y Neurocirugía in Mexico City. Three different EITB tests were applied to participants' serum samples (LDBio, France; US Centers for Disease Control and Prevention [CDC]; and Instituto de Diagnóstico y Referencia Epidemiológicos [InDRE]). There was substantial variability in specific glycoprotein band patterns among the three assays. However, in age- and sex-adjusted logistic regression models, the number of glycoprotein bands was positively associated with the presence of vesicular extraparenchymal cysts (InDRE adjusted odds ratio [aOR] 1.60 p < 0.001; CDC aOR 6.31 p < 0.001; LDBio aOR 2.45 p < 0.001) and negatively associated with the presence of calcified parenchymal cysts (InDRE aOR 0.63 p < 0.001; CDC aOR 0.25 p < 0.001; LDBio aOR 0.44 p < 0.001). In a sensitivity analysis also adjusting for cyst count, results were similar. In all three EITB serum antibody tests, the number of glycoprotein bands consistently predicted cyst stage and location, although magnitude of effect differed.
